    Troubleshoot Ally in ChatGPT

    Answers for the most common questions about connecting Ally to ChatGPT and controlling what it can see.

    Common issues

    • I cannot find Ally in ChatGPT

      Ally is not currently publicly listed. Public availability will be announced on the Ally for ChatGPT overview page. Availability and labels can also vary by ChatGPT plan, workspace, role, region, and surface.

    • Sign-in or consent did not complete

      Return to ChatGPT and start the connection flow again. If the browser did not return you to ChatGPT, close the tab and retry. Make sure you are signing in to the correct Ally account.

    • My aquatic spaces are missing

      The connector shows only spaces on the signed-in Ally account. Confirm you signed in with the right account and that the spaces exist in Ally.

    • The result is not current

      Tools return the data as stored in Ally at the moment of the request. If you recently made changes in the Ally app, save them and ask ChatGPT again so it re-fetches the data.

    • ChatGPT did not use the expected Ally tool

      Rephrase your prompt to name the space or task explicitly. Prompts like the ones on the How to use page reliably call the matching tool.

    • I want to change data or complete a task

      The connection is read-only. Make the change in the Ally app, then ask ChatGPT again so it retrieves the updated data.

    • I want to disconnect Ally in ChatGPT

      Open ChatGPT app or connector settings and disconnect Ally there. That stops future tool access from ChatGPT.

    • I want to remove prior data from ChatGPT

      Manage past ChatGPT conversations, memory, and data controls inside ChatGPT. Ally cannot delete ChatGPT conversations or memories.
